Jeddah: Saudi Arabia has started preparations for its second Group H fixture at the FIFA World Cup 2026, with the Green Falcons turning their attention to a crucial encounter against Spain following a determined performance in their opening match.
Head coach Georgios Donis, the Saudi national team held a training session at Q2 Stadium in Austin on Wednesday as players focused on maintaining momentum ahead of Sunday’s highly anticipated clash.
Saudi Arabia enters the match with confidence after securing a valuable point in its tournament opener against Uruguay.
The Green Falcons showed resilience and discipline to earn a 1-1 draw in Miami on Monday despite facing sustained pressure from the South American side for large portions of the game.
The result placed Saudi Arabia in a strong position within a tightly contested Group H.
Earlier in the round, European champions Spain were unexpectedly held to a goalless draw by World Cup newcomers Cape Verde, creating one of the biggest surprises of the tournament’s opening week.
With both opening matches ending in draws, all four teams in Group H—Saudi Arabia, Uruguay, Spain, and Cape Verde currently sit level on one point, leaving qualification for the knockout stages wide open.
